DIGEST SB 241 Original 2017 Regular Session Johns Present law partially suspends the state sales and use tax exemption for sales and purchases of orthotic devices, prosthetic devices, prostheses and restorative materials utilized by or prescribed by dentists in connection with health care treatment subjecting these purchases to state sales and use tax at the rate of three percent until July 1, 2018. Proposed law exempts sales and purchases of orthotic devices, prosthetic devices, prostheses and restorative materials utilized by or prescribed by dentists in connection with health care treatment from all state sales and use tax beginning July 1, 2017. Effective upon signature of the governor or lapse of time for gubernatorial action. (Adds R.S. 47:302(BB) and 321.1(F)(67))
